Output 3c85d2453949245c9ae84f61fb3965f065e4b0857d2b879da7670925d306bb63:13

value
39737616
script pubkey
OP_0 OP_PUSHBYTES_20 290138b97a4f12d69e70ea49e67f6bd07bdff5fb
address
ltc1q9yqn3wt6fufdd8nsafy7vlmt6paala0m95klte
transaction
3c85d2453949245c9ae84f61fb3965f065e4b0857d2b879da7670925d306bb63
spent
true